Detailed Meaning
This name reflects the Sumerian belief in mountain temples as bridges between earth and heaven. It evokes the ziggurat builders and priest-kings who ruled the first cities of Uruk and Ur.
Derived from ancient Sumerian temple traditions where mountains were seen as bridges between earth and heaven. This name reflects the divine authority of priest-kings who ruled the first city-states along the Euphrates.
